Slitter Operator - 2nd Shift
About the role
Your main responsibility is to setup and operate a slitter according to customer specifications and work orders. You'll also be responsible for regular equipment inspection and the ability to measure dimensions, align parts, and produce material according to production instructions.
Responsibilities
- Make and inspect arbor and overarm set-ups to ensure compliance with production instructions
- Reconcile coil identity to production and load coil
- Thread coil through slitter head, cropping non-complying material
- Thread mults into recoiler
- Maintain production and quality standards by measuring and verifying before, during, and after processing
- Check and record gauge width, hardness, camber, burr, and surface condition
- Set gauge monitoring system (if applicable) and ensure gauge calibration
- Adjust machine setup to correct defects as needed throughout slitting (if applicable)
- Communicate non-compliance production to supervisor and/or shift lead
- Band/secure and identify slit mults
- Complete production documentation
- Absorb maintenance to troubleshoot malfunctions or complete preventative maintenance as necessary
- Remove scrap from machine and empty hopper as needed
- Clean slitter and surrounding area
Requirements
- Ability to perform complete set-up and operational tasks of slitting to ensure compliance with customer specifications and production requirements
- Ability to use tape measures, Rockwell tester, micrometers, and calipers
- Ability to comply with safety rules and requirements
- Regular lifting and moving of up to 10 pounds, frequently up to 25 pounds, and occasionally up to 50 pounds
